The Beginning Life Well, to explain that, I want to take you on a little journey, all the way back to the beginnings of the Earth.  Where we are now, there is nothing. Well, not really nothing, but nothing interesting. There are only simple things, like these blobs. This one might be a carbon dioxide molecule, or it might be cyanide. We don't know for sure what they are, but we do know that these compounds are very simple. So for now, they'll just be blobs floating around our void. In fact, much of what we'll encounter along our journey here are just hypotheses. A lot of Earth's early history is still a mystery, so keep that in mind.  Now, every so often, our blobs get a surplus of energy, maybe from a ray of UV light or a nearby hot source. This is the first major upgrade to our void, excess energy, as it allows our blobs to interact with each other....

Yeah, you're right. But survival of the fittest species or the fittest group also doesn't work.  I mean, think about what you need for natural selection to occur. You need something that replicates itself many times over, creating copies, and then you need a pruning process, whereby some of those copies get eliminated and some thrive to go on and create more copies. The problem with groups or species is that they don’t typically make copies of themselves.  So you almost never get copies of groups fighting other copies of groups to see which groups win out.
